.curator is a narrative adventure set in a post-Victorian alternate Earth - you play as a Curator using quantum-modeling tech to glimpse possible futures and subtly rewrite events before they spiral.
A few things worth highlighting:
- Fully hand-drawn characters and environments
- Investigating the ruins of an ancient alien civilization buried in this world's past
- No combat-first design - fight, hide, distract, or charm your way through
- Choices carry real weight - the people you fail to save stay failed
Having Morgan write it directly means the world's internal logic, from how the tech works to how power functions in this alternate history, comes from someone who's already built it out in his head rather than reverse-engineered by a studio.
